--
-- Translated from https://github.com/advancedtelematic/quickcheck-state-machine/blob/7e3056d493ad430cfacd62da7878955e80fd296f/example/src/MutableReference.hs
--
{-# LANGUAGE KindSignatures #-}
{-# LANGUAGE TemplateHaskell #-}
module Test.Example.References where

import Control.Monad.IO.Class (MonadIO(..))

import Data.Bifunctor (second)
import Data.IORef (IORef)
import qualified Data.IORef as IORef
import qualified Data.List as List

import Hedgehog
import qualified Hedgehog.Gen as Gen
import qualified Hedgehog.Range as Range


------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- State

data Ref v =
Ref (v (Opaque (IORef Int)))

data State v =
State {
stateRefs :: [(Ref v, Int)]
} deriving (Eq, Show)

initialState :: State v
initialState =
State []

instance Eq1 v => Eq (Ref v) where
(==) (Ref x) (Ref y) =
eq1 x y

instance Show1 v => Show (Ref v) where
showsPrec p (Ref x) =
showParen (p >= 11) $
showString "Ref " .
showsPrec1 11 x

instance HTraversable Ref where
htraverse f (Ref v) =
fmap Ref (f v)

------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- NewRef

data NewRef (v :: * -> *) =
NewRef
deriving (Eq, Show)

instance HTraversable NewRef where
htraverse _ NewRef =
pure NewRef

newRef :: Monad m => Command m IO State
newRef =
let
gen _s =
Just $
pure NewRef

execute _i =
fmap Opaque . liftIO $ IORef.newIORef 0
in
Command gen execute [
Update $ \(State xs) _i o ->
State $
xs ++ [(Ref o, 0)]
]

------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- ReadRef

data ReadRef v =
ReadRef (Ref v)
deriving (Eq, Show)

instance HTraversable ReadRef where
htraverse f (ReadRef ref) =
ReadRef <$> htraverse f ref

readRef :: Monad m => Command m IO State
readRef =
let
gen s =
case stateRefs s of
[] ->
Nothing
xs ->
Just $
ReadRef <$> Gen.element (fmap fst xs)

execute (ReadRef (Ref (Concrete (Opaque ref)))) =
liftIO $ IORef.readIORef ref
in
Command gen execute [
Require $ \(State xs) (ReadRef ref) ->
elem ref $ fmap fst xs

, Ensure $ \s (ReadRef ref) o ->
lookup ref (stateRefs s) === Just o
]

------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- WriteRef

data WriteRef v =
WriteRef (Ref v) Int
deriving (Eq, Show)

instance HTraversable WriteRef where
htraverse f (WriteRef ref x) =
WriteRef <$> htraverse f ref <*> pure x

writeRef :: Monad m => Command m IO State
writeRef =
let
gen s =
case stateRefs s of
[] ->
Nothing
xs ->
Just $
WriteRef
<$> Gen.element (fmap fst xs)
<*> Gen.int (Range.linear 0 100)

execute (WriteRef (Ref (Concrete (Opaque ref))) x) =
liftIO $ IORef.writeIORef ref x
in
Command gen execute [
Require $ \(State xs) (WriteRef ref _) ->
elem ref $ fmap fst xs

, Update $ \(State xs) (WriteRef ref x) _o ->
State $
(ref, x) : filter ((/= ref) . fst) xs
]

------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- IncRef

data IncRef v =
IncRef (Ref v)
deriving (Eq, Show)

instance HTraversable IncRef where
htraverse f (IncRef ref) =
IncRef <$> htraverse f ref

incRef :: Monad m => Command m IO State
incRef =
let
gen s =
case stateRefs s of
[] ->
Nothing
xs ->
Just $
IncRef <$> Gen.element (fmap fst xs)

execute (IncRef (Ref (Concrete (Opaque ref)))) = do
x <- liftIO $ IORef.readIORef ref
liftIO $ IORef.writeIORef ref (x + 2) -- deliberate bug
in
Command gen execute [
Require $ \(State xs) (IncRef ref) ->
elem ref $ fmap fst xs

, Update $ \(State xs) (IncRef ref) _o ->
State $
let
(xs1, xs2) =
List.partition ((== ref) . fst) xs
in
fmap (second (+1)) xs1 ++ xs2
]

------------------------------------------------------------------------

prop_references :: Property
prop_references =
property $ do
actions <- forAll $
Gen.actions (Range.linear 1 100) initialState [newRef, readRef, writeRef, incRef]

executeSequential initialState actions

------------------------------------------------------------------------

return []
tests :: IO Bool
tests =
checkParallel $$(discover)
